Early Beginnings and Career Trajectory

Mullin’s footballing journey began in the youth ranks of Liverpool, a city with a rich footballing heritage. Though he didn’t break into the first team at Anfield, his time there laid a crucial foundation, instilling the discipline and work ethic that would define his later career. 

His early professional experiences were marked by spells at clubs like Huddersfield Town and Morecambe, where he began to establish himself as a capable forward.

His breakthrough came at Cambridge United. During his time at the Abbey Stadium, Mullin showcased his goal-scoring prowess, earning the League Two Golden Boot in the 2020-2021 season. 

This achievement significantly elevated his profile, attracting attention from clubs higher up the footballing pyramid. However, it was his decision to join Wrexham AFC, then in the National League, that would truly define his career and capture the imagination of fans worldwide.

The Wrexham Phenomenon

Mullin’s arrival at Wrexham coincided with the club’s high-profile takeover by actors Ryan Reynolds and Rob McElhenney. The duo’s ambition to transform the club into a global force resonated with Mullin, who saw an opportunity to be part of something extraordinary. His decision to drop down a division surprised many, but it proved to be a masterstroke.

At Wrexham, Mullin became a pivotal figure, a symbol of the club’s resurgence. His goal-scoring exploits were instrumental in their promotion to League Two, and his performances consistently defied expectations. 

He became a cult hero, his name chanted from the stands, his image adorning banners and merchandise. The documentary series “Welcome to Wrexham” further amplified his popularity, showcasing his personality and dedication to the club and its community.
